BILL SUMMARY For HB19-1240

SENATE COMMITTEE ON FINANCE
Date Apr 25, 2019      
Location SCR 357



HB19-1240 - Referred to the Committee of the Whole - Consent Calendar


06:24:12 PM  

Senators Court and Tate, bill sponsors, introduced House Bill 19-1240. The bill affects sales and use tax administration, including codifying collection rules, requiring marketplace facilitators, and repealing obsolete statutory references.
